The verdict

Engineered Materials : Lexington runs at 22% of its industry's injury rate - far safer than the typical Gasket, Packing, and Sealing Device Manufacturing workplace, earning a grade A.

Engineered Materials : Lexington injury rate improved

Engineered Materials : Lexington's TCR fell 1.1 from 1.1 in 2018 to 0.0 in 2023. Peak filing year was 2021 at 1.1 TCR. In 2023, DART was 0×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

2018=1.1 · 2019=1.0 · 2020=0.6 · 2021=1.1 · 2022=0.5 · 2023=0.0

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2023 0.0 0.0 0 0 0
2022 0.5 0.5 1 0 0
2021 1.1 0.0 2 0 0
2020 0.6 0.0 1 0 0
2019 1.0 1.0 2 0 0
2018 1.1 1.1 1 1 0
